Fête de la Tulipe in Morges

The annual Fête de la Tulipe in Morges is one of the most beautiful spring events on Lake Geneva in Switzerland. Around 150,000 tulips, daffodils, and hyacinths can be enjoyed blooming in the Parc de l’Indépendence à Morges behind the chateau on the Lac Léman lakefront. Wine Tasting in the Lake Geneva Region of Switzerland

Lavaux on Lake Geneva in Autumn

Open cellars, or Caves ouvertes, are popular in the Lake Geneva region and provide excellent opportunities for tasting Swiss wine in an informal setting without pressure to buy expensive bottles. Swiss Classic British Car Meeting in Morges

British Classic Cars Parked in front of the Chateau de Morges

Morges in Switzerland hosts a free but very impressive show day for around 1,500 British classic cars in the parks and on the quays of Lake Geneva. Chateau and Top Sights to See in Coppet near Geneva

Chateau de Coppet Allee

Château de Coppet, a palace associated with Neckar and Mme de Staël, is the top sight in this pretty Lake Geneva port village just north of Genève. Visit the Roman Museum and Basilica in Nyon, Switzerland

Roman pillar in Nyon with view of Lake Geneva

The Musée Romain et Basilique is located amongst the foundations of a first-century Roman basilica in Nyon on Lake Geneva in Switzerland near Genève.
